Somewhere in his writings (I can't begin to recall where) Joseph Ratzinger commented that the expressions of romantic love in popular music often have in them an inkling of recognition of divine love. He explained (paraphrasing very broadly): In popular love songs, the lyrics often speak of love as being eternal: "Our love will last forever," "I will always love you baby," etc. They thus recognize that true love by its nature is eternal, and this is consistent with Christian dogma that God is eternal and God is love - that God is eternal love.
